Miss Mexicana
Wynnum
Miss Mexicana is a stunning, split-level Mexican restaurant and bar in Wynnum offering authentic Mexican food and drinks.
Nestled on Bay Terrace, Miss Mexicana takes over the spaces formerly occupied by Mr Hibachi and The Fat Duck; with a more formal restaurant upstairs and a less formal Mexican-style cantina downstairs.
The upstairs dining room is a feast for the eyes, featuring vibrant, terracotta-coloured walls, with wicker lamp shades and greenery hanging from the high ceiling. The spacious dining area is filled with tables and chairs including a large round table for big groups, plus bench seating along one wall with colourful cushions scattered along it.
The iconic Mexican painter Frida Kahlo is featured throughout, on the walls and the cushions, with additional decor including Mexican folk art, sequined sombreros and cacti.
The mouth-watering menu boasts authentic Mexican fare. Start with Pina Asada (grilled pineapple, spiced nuts, romesco sauce and tequila syrup), Jalapenos Rellenos (panko-crumbed jalapeno chillies stuffed with chorizo, cream and mozzarella cheese) or traditional ceviche (fresh raw fish cured in citrus with avocado, tomato, onion and coriander).
Mains dishes include Mole de Pato (confit duck leg, mole sauce, rice and beans), Carne Asada (Mexican-style marinated rump steak served with kidney beans and pico de gallo), Carne Barbacoa (braised beef cheek in house made marinade served with beans and adobo sauce), Chicken Encilada, and Tazón Mixto (Mexican bowl of coriander rice, red beans, corn, pico de gallo, gaucamole, corn chips, and salsa).
In addition, there's an array of shared platters suitable for large groups, offering a range of traditional Mexican fare.
Diners can satisfy their sweet tooth with the delicious desserts on offer - Torta de Queso (baked cheesecake with dulce de leche) and Churros (Spanish doughnuts served with dipping sauce).
Downstairs, the ground level eatery and bar provides seating inside and out, with tables and chairs spilling out onto the footpath.
The bar menu boasts a tasty selection of Mexican street food, from Totopos (corn chips with house made guacamole) and Chilaquiles (corn chips with marinated chicken, tomatillo sauce and sour cream), to a variety of tacos - battered fish, marinated chicken, grilled beef brisket, slow-cooked pork, and grilled cauliflower.
Miss Mexicana is fully licenced with a curated wine list that consists of Australian and International wines, craft beer on tap, spirits, and cocktails including the classic Margarita, Spicy Margarita (infused with birds eye chilli), Coconut Margarita (based on 1800 Coconut Tequila, garnished with toasted coconut flakes), and Michelada - a classic Mexican cocktail with bite, concocted with Mexican lager, Clamato, lemon juice, Worcestershire, Tabasco, soy and salsa de tamarindo.
Nice to know - Miss Mexican is child-friendly with a dedicated menu for Niños including Pollo Asado (grilled chicken, rice and beans) and Totopos (corn chips topped with mozzarella, chicken or beef and sour cream).
